Amanda Mantra, a rising star in indie music, has teamed up with the exceptionally talented DAYANA to create a stunning and empowering track called "Not The One." This remarkable work of art is a testament to the power of female creativity, as it was written, produced, performed, recorded, and mixed entirely by women.

"Not The One" takes listeners on a compelling and relatable journey through the ups and downs of various types of relationships, romantic or familial. With a captivating melody and lyrics that cut straight to the heart, this song resonates with anyone who has ever struggled to establish boundaries and prioritize their self-worth. It's not just a breakup anthem – it's a resounding call to embrace self-empowerment.

The soulful and sultry sounds of Amanda Mantra blend effortlessly with DAYANA's enchanting harmonies, creating a sonic tapestry that is as emotionally charged as it is musically exquisite. The synergy between these two exceptional artists is palpable, and their collaboration adds a unique depth to the track that is impossible to ignore.

"Not The One" is an anthem for anyone who has ever found themselves stuck in toxic relationships and yearned for the strength to break free. It's a reminder that everyone deserves better, and sometimes, the most influential act of self-love is saying no to those who don't respect your boundaries.

With its catchy and infectious melody, this song will resonate with a broad audience, and its message of empowerment is timely and timeless. As Amanda Mantra and DAYANA come together to create this female-led masterpiece, they produce incredible music, break down barriers, and pave the way for more women in the industry to make their mark. This collaboration is a powerful example of what can be achieved when women support each other and work together to create something extraordinary.
